Took my car to the place under the flyover this morning. A few minutes on the rolling road and a sensor stuck up the exhaust pipe. There no more than 20 minutes. Go back Saturday to collect tax disc.
Charges in Thai as I understand them; Test 200 Baht, insurance 645 Baht, Tax 194 Baht, fee 100 Baht, Total to pay 1,139 Baht.

I only bought the car this year so never paid last year and the blue book is still at the garage, I have to collect it with new tax disc on Saturday.

I've done a quick Google on price and all I could find is after 5 years it reduces by 10% a year to a maximum of 50% so it's reduced by 50% as it's more than ten years old.

I've done a quick Google on price and all I could find is after 5 years it reduces by 10% a year to a maximum of 50% so it's reduced by 50% as it's more than ten years old.
Yes that is basically correct, except that is 6 years and then in the seventh year it starts to reduce and needs inspecting. In the 10th year and after it remains the same. (unless it has been changed recently)
